Homecrest Community Services, Inc.

Homecrest Community Services, Inc. Homecrest Community Services, Inc.

(HCS) is a non-profit, IRS 501C(3) which provide community-based, multi-social services for older adults, youth and families living in Southern Brooklyn.

We are grateful to our incredible partners at Asian Americans for Equality for teaming up with us to provide a workshop at our Multi-Social Services Center! They broke down the heavy realities of HR 1 and what these federal changes mean for everyone relying on SNAP and Medicaid.

We appreciate all the community members who attended to learn and to get ahead of the upcoming changes, especially the Medicaid work requirements kicking off January 1, 2027, and the 20-hour weekly work rules for maintaining SNAP benefits.

We are proud to stand alongside AAFE to make sure our community stays informed and prepared!

Homecrest Community Services was proud to come together with the Cpc Brooklyn Community Services, Perlmutter Cancer Center Radiation Oncology at NYU Langone, and Blood Cancer United for a wonderful day celebrating community, culture, healthy aging, and connection.

The room was filled with the sound of Mahjong tiles, laughter, friendly competition, and plenty of excitement as older adults gathered around the tables to enjoy both Cantonese and Fuzhounese Mahjong.

For many of our older adults, Mahjong is much more than a game. It is part of our cultural tradition, a way to exercise the mind, strengthen strategic thinking, build friendships, and stay socially connected. Seeing so many participants enjoying themselves together was truly heartwarming.

We were especially grateful to our health partners for being on-site to provide important education and resources on cancer prevention, early detection, and screening services. Bringing health information directly into a familiar and welcoming community setting is one of the ways we can help older adults feel more comfortable accessing the resources they need.

Congratulations to our Mahjong winners! But beyond the competition, the biggest win was seeing our community laughing, learning, connecting, and enjoying the day together.

This is what community partnership looks like—combining culture, health, friendship, and fun to create meaningful experiences for our older adults.

We are incredibly grateful to share the success of our Fresh Produce Distribution on August 7.

This was about so much more than handing out bags of fresh fruits and vegetables. It was about caring for our older adults, supporting one another, and reminding our community that no one should feel alone or forgotten.

Our heartfelt thanks go to our 23 amazing volunteers who gave their time, energy, and hearts to make this possible. From packing and organizing to welcoming older adults and carrying bags of produce, every helping hand made a difference. Seeing different generations working side by side was especially meaningful—it is a beautiful reminder that community has no age limit.

We were deeply honored to welcome Ryan Murray, Executive Deputy Commissioner & Chief Program Officer of NYC Department for the Aging, along with members of the NYC Aging team, who didn't simply come to visit—they rolled up their sleeves and worked alongside us throughout the distribution. That kind of hands-on support means so much to our staff, volunteers, and older adults.

We were also grateful to welcome Council Member Susan Zhuang, Chair of the NYC Council Committee on Aging, who stopped by to encourage our volunteers and spend time with our older adults. Thank you for continuing to stand with and advocate for our community.

Behind every bag of produce is an older adult, a family, and a story. At a time when the cost of everyday necessities continues to place pressure on so many households, being able to bring fresh, healthy food directly into the hands of our older adultsmeans more than we can express.
